In this episode of the Shingo Principles Podcast, we hear from Chris Butterworth. Chris is an experienced consultant, a Shingo Master Trainer, and a Shingo Faculty Fellow. He is also an author and editor of several books, including the Enterprise Alignment and Results book sponsored by the Shingo Institute, which you can find online at http://shingo.org/books. Chris is also author of, Why Bother, Why and How to Assess Your Continuous-Improvement Culture, which you will learn more about today.

The book, Why Bother?, was written by Chris Butterworth alongside Lean experts Morgan Jones and Peter Hines. It focuses on the importance of behavior in embedding a continuous improvement culture and how to assess it. Many organizations conduct Lean audits with traditional tools, which raises the question: Why bother looking at things in a different way? In doing so, you have the chance to review strengths and opportunities and to take your continuous improvement culture to the next level.
